SQL数据库的表如何添加皮肤、使用视图、使用HTML和CSS、使用外部工具
为SQL数据库的表添加皮肤可以通过多种方式实现,包括使用视图、HTML和CSS以及外部工具。使用视图、使用HTML和CSS、使用外部工具是主要的方法。其中,使用HTML和CSS是最常见的方式,通过将数据库查询结果嵌入到网页中,并使用CSS来美化表格的外观。本文将详细介绍这些方法及其实现步骤。
一、使用视图
1.1 创建视图
SQL视图是一个虚拟表,其内容由一个SQL查询定义。视图可以帮助你将复杂的查询结果简化,并提高数据的可读性。创建视图的语法如下:
CREATE VIEW view_name AS
SELECT column1, column2, ...
FROM table_name
WHERE condition;
例如,假设我们有一个名为employees
的表,我们希望创建一个视图来显示员工的姓名和职位:
CREATE VIEW employee_view AS
SELECT first_name, last_name, position
FROM employees;
1.2 使用视图查询数据
创建视图后,可以像查询普通表一样查询视图:
SELECT * FROM employee_view;
使用视图可以帮助你简化复杂的查询,并在需要时快速访问数据。
二、使用HTML和CSS
2.1 将查询结果嵌入HTML
将SQL查询结果嵌入HTML页面是美化表格的常见方式。首先,需要使用服务器端脚本语言(如PHP、Python、Node.js等)从数据库获取数据,然后将数据嵌入HTML表格中。
例如,使用PHP和MySQL:
<?php
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"database";
//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);
// 检测连接
if ($conn->connect_error) {
die("连接失败: " . $conn->connect_error);
}
$sql = "SELECT first_name, last_name, position FROM employees";
$result = $conn->query($sql);
if ($result->num_rows > 0) {
echo "<table>";
echo "<tr><th>First Name</th><th>Last Name</th><th>Position</th></tr>";
while($row = $result->fetch_assoc()) {
echo "<tr><td>" . $row["first_name"]. "</td><td>" . $row["last_name"]. "</td><td>" . $row["position"]. "</td></tr>";
}
echo "</table>";
} else {
echo "0 结果";
}
$conn->close();
?>
2.2 使用CSS美化表格
创建HTML表格后,可以使用CSS来美化表格的外观。以下是一个简单的CSS示例:
table {
width: 100%;
border-collapse: collapse;
}
table, th, td {
border: 1px solid black;
}
th, td {
padding: 15px;
text-align: left;
}
th {
background-color: #f2f2f2;
}
将上述CSS代码添加到HTML页面的<style>
标签中,可以使表格看起来更加美观。
三、使用外部工具
3.1 数据库管理工具
一些数据库管理工具提供了内置的表格美化功能。例如,SQL Server Management Studio(SSMS)和DBeaver等工具可以帮助你以更加直观的方式查看和管理数据库表。
3.2 BI工具
商业智能(BI)工具如Tableau、Power BI和Looker等可以帮助你创建交互式和可视化的报表。这些工具通常支持与各种数据库的集成,并提供丰富的图表和表格样式。
四、使用项目管理系统
在团队协作和项目管理中,使用项目管理系统可以帮助你更好地管理和展示数据库表。例如,研发项目管理系统PingCode和通用项目协作软件Worktile都是非常优秀的选择。
4.1 研发项目管理系统PingCode
PingCode是一款专为研发项目设计的管理系统,支持从需求管理、任务跟踪到代码管理的全过程管理。它具有强大的数据可视化功能,可以帮助你更好地展示和分析数据库表中的数据。
4.2 通用项目协作软件Worktile
Worktile是一款通用的项目协作软件,适用于各种类型的项目管理。它支持任务管理、文件共享、时间跟踪等功能,并提供丰富的数据展示和分析工具,帮助你更好地管理和展示数据库表中的数据。
五、总结
为SQL数据库的表添加皮肤可以通过多种方式实现,包括使用视图、使用HTML和CSS、使用外部工具。每种方法都有其优点和适用场景,可以根据实际需求选择合适的方法。此外,使用项目管理系统如PingCode和Worktile可以帮助你更好地管理和展示数据库表中的数据,提高团队协作效率。
相关问答FAQs:
1. 如何在sql数据库的表中添加一个皮肤字段?
- 首先,您需要在数据库中的相应表中创建一个新的列,用于存储皮肤信息。
- 然后,您可以使用ALTER TABLE语句来修改表结构,以添加新的皮肤字段。
- 通过执行以下SQL语句,您可以将皮肤字段添加到现有的表中:
ALTER TABLE 表名
ADD 皮肤字段名 数据类型;
- 您可以根据需要选择适当的数据类型,例如VARCHAR用于存储文本数据,或者INT用于存储数值数据。
2. 如何将皮肤信息插入到数据库表中?
- 首先,您需要使用INSERT INTO语句将新的记录插入到表中。
- 通过执行以下SQL语句,您可以将皮肤信息插入到数据库表中:
INSERT INTO 表名 (字段1, 字段2, 皮肤字段名)
VALUES (值1, 值2, 皮肤值);
- 在上述语句中,您需要将字段1和字段2替换为相应的字段名,将值1和值2替换为相应的值,以及将皮肤字段名替换为您在第一步中创建的皮肤字段名。
3. 如何更新数据库表中的皮肤信息?
- 首先,您需要使用UPDATE语句来更新表中的记录。
- 通过执行以下SQL语句,您可以更新数据库表中的皮肤信息:
UPDATE 表名
SET 皮肤字段名 = 新的皮肤值
WHERE 条件;
- 在上述语句中,您需要将表名替换为相应的表名,将皮肤字段名替换为您在第一步中创建的皮肤字段名,将新的皮肤值替换为您想要更新的皮肤值,并根据需要指定适当的条件。
原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2102640